the reasons and guidelines
It basically means why and how these please clearance reports are to be issued.
I think "reasons" works pretty well for "supuestos" in this context, but you could also use "circumstances," "situations," "rationale," "conditions," or possibly even "principles."
By the way, in ref. to the other suggestion above, "acuerdo" doesn't mean an "agreement" here; this is a "resolution" of the executive branch. The "procurardor" isn't agreeing with anyone when they issue these, rather they're issuing an order.
